About El Último de la Fila

El Último de la Fila emerged from the vibrant Barcelona music scene in the early 1980s, quickly establishing themselves as a groundbreaking force. Spearheaded by the distinctive songwriting partnership of Manolo García and Quimi Portet, the band blended rock sensibilities with a poetic introspection rarely heard in mainstream Spanish music. Their early work, often characterised by a more experimental and raw sound, garnered critical acclaim, but it was their more melodic and accessible compositions that propelled them to superstardom.

Throughout the 80s and 90s, El Último de la Fila released a string of seminal albums, each one showcasing their evolution and unwavering commitment to lyrical depth and musical innovation. Songs like “Insurrección,” “Yo No Soy Yo,” and “La Flaca” became anthems, resonating with a generation and demonstrating their mastery of storytelling through song. “La Flaca,” in particular, achieved immense global success, transcending language barriers with its infectious rhythm and evocative imagery. Their discography is a testament to their artistic longevity, marked by critically lauded albums such as “Enemigos Íntimos,” “Astronomía Interna,” and “Amberes,” each revealing new facets of their musical prowess. The band’s unique ability to weave intricate narratives with captivating melodies, delivered with Manolo García’s distinctive vocal delivery, has cemented their status as one of Spain’s most cherished and influential musical acts. Even after their hiatus and subsequent solo careers, the reunion of El Último de la Fila for significant tours like this one is met with immense anticipation and adoration.
